Bear Basin Lookout (Six ... WebWhat’s the point of a lookout tower? Fire towers started gaining popularity in the early 1900s as the primary way for spotting wildfires. Perched high on the mountain top, these manned towers provided an excellent view point for smoke columns and flames. Built in 1934 and active … my wix appWebPainted all white, Calpine Lookout shines like a beacon on its 5,980 foot hilltop hideaway in California’s Sierra Nevada Mountains. It’s also one of the last three windmill-style lookouts you’ll find in California. Like the other two, Girard and Sardine, Calpine was built by the Civilian Conservation Corps in the early 1930s. the sims 4 outfits modWebReservation Rules. Little Mt. Hoffman Lookout was constructed in the 1920s and was used by the Forest Service on a regular basis until 1978. It is one of the few remaining historic lookouts in the Shasta-Trinity National Forest and is eligible for listing on the National Register of Historic Places.
